Basic Life Support (BLS) is a level of medical care used for victims of life-threatening illnesses or injuries until they can be given full medical care at a hospital. It is generally used by first responders, including paramedics, emergency medical technicians (EMTs), police officers, and firefighters. Here are the key components:
